Multiple gunshot victims reported in West Texas shootings
Authorities in Midland, Texas, are responding to an active shooter incidents, with at least 20 victims. The shooting appears to have begun in Midland. The suspect, possibly two, then drove to Odessa, randomly shooting at people on the street from a stolen mail truck. Source
